Safety Precaution Definitions
Caution! Damage to equipment may result if this precaution is disregarded.
Warning! Direct injury to personnel or damage to equipment which can cause injury to
personnel may result if this precaution is not followed.
Note Qualified personnel are required for installation of this product in a hazardous
environment.
Safety Precautions
Read this manual carefully and make sure you understand its contents before using this product.
Follow all instructions and safety guidelines presented in this manual when using this product.
If the user does not follow these instructions properly, Varec cannot guarantee the safety of the
system.
Note Comply with all applicable regulations, codes, and standards. For safety precautions,
the user should refer to the appropriate industry or military standards.
Caution! Electrical Hazard! Read and understand static and lightning electrical protection
and grounding described in API 2003. Make certain that the tank installation, operation,
and maintenance conforms with the practice set forth therein.
Warning! Striking the gaugehead of the transmitter with a metal object could cause a
spark to occur. When removing or replacing the gaugehead in flammable or hazardous
liquid storage areas, take necessary measures to protect the gaugehead from impact.
Warning! Volatile fumes may be present! Ensure that the tank has been leak and pressure
tested as appropriate for the liquid to be stored. Observe appropriate safety precautions in
flammable or hazardous liquid storage areas. Do not enter a tank that has contained
hydrocarbons, vapors, or toxic materials, until a gas-free environment is certified. Carry
breathing equipment when entering a tank where oxygen may be displaced by carbon
dioxide, nitrogen, or other gases. Wear safety glasses as appropriate. Use a hard hat.
Warning! Sparks or static charge could cause fire or explosion! The mechanical
connections between the guide cables, the float, the tape, and the gaugehead provide a
resistance to ground that is adequate for the safe electrical drain of electrostatic charges
that may accumulate in the tank and the product. Worker activity and worker clothing may
accumulate electrostatic charges on the body of a worker. Care should be used in
flammable environments to avoid the hazard.
